ED - Schaa, Volker RW ED - Power, Maria ED - Shiltsev, Vladimir ED - White, Marion TI - Modulator Simulations for Coherent Electron Cooling J2 - Proc. of NAPAC2016, Chicago, IL, USA, October 9-14, 2016 C1 - Chicago, IL, USA T2 - North American Particle Accelerator Conference T3 - 3 LA - english AB - Highly resolved numerical simulations of the modulator, the first section of the proposed coherent electron cooling (CEC) device, have been performed using the code SPACE. The beam parameters for simulations are relevant to the Relativistic Heavy Ion Collider (RHIC) at Brookhaven National Laboratory (BNL). Numerical convergence has been studied using various numbers of macro-particles and mesh refinements of computational domain. A good agreement of theory and simulations has been obtained for the case of stationary and moving ions in uniform electron clouds with realistic distribution of thermal velocities. The main result of the paper is the prediction of modulation processes for ions with reference and off-reference coordinates in realistic Gaussian electron bunches with quadrupole field.
